炼丹蓝图官方网站前端项目,基于 Nuxt 构建,提供多语言展示、SEO 优化、结构化数据与可维护的组件化页面架构。
sitemap.xml 与 robots.txtNuxtVue 3@nuxtjs/i18n@nuxt/image@vueuse/nuxtassets/styles/global.css)任选一个包管理器:
# npm
npm install
# yarn
yarn install
# pnpm
pnpm install
# bun
bun install
# npm
npm run dev
# yarn
yarn dev
# pnpm
pnpm dev
# bun
bun run dev
默认访问地址:http://localhost:3000
# 构建
npm run build
# 预览构建产物
npm run preview
# 静态生成
npm run generate
.
├─ app.vue # 应用入口
├─ nuxt.config.js # Nuxt 全局配置(SEO/i18n/缓存/预渲染)
├─ package.json # 依赖与脚本
├─ pages/
│ └─ index.vue # 首页
├─ layouts/
│ └─ default.vue # 全局布局
├─ components/ # 首页与通用组件
├─ composables/ # 组合式能力(SEO、Schema.org)
├─ data/ # 页面静态数据
├─ i18n/locales/ # 多语言文案
├─ assets/styles/
│ └─ global.css # 全局样式与设计变量
├─ public/ # 静态资源
├─ server/routes/ # 服务端路由(robots/sitemap)
└─ scripts/ # 部署脚本与说明
zh-CN/en-USi18n/locales/zh-CN.js、i18n/locales/en-US.jsnuxt.config.js@nuxt/image 进行优化输出脚本定义见 package.json。
dev:本地开发build:生产构建preview:预览构建结果generate:静态生成postinstall:Nuxt 准备步骤项目包含 FTP 增量部署脚本:
本项目采用 GNU General Public License v3.0。
如对外分发修改版本,请遵循 GPL v3 相关义务(包括保留许可证与开放对应源码)。